What is an on-pipe transmitter?
On-pipe dripper is a kind of dripper embedded in capillary, which can be directly installed on capillary in production workshop through automatic production line according to user's needs. You can also directly punch holes in the capillary with special tools during construction, and then insert the transmitter into the capillary. For example, microtube emitter, button emitter and orifice emitter are all on-pipe emitters, which were used more in the early stage of drip irrigation development. The transmitter with pressure compensation function installed on the capillary tube is called on-pipe compensation transmitter. This kind of emitter has the advantages of flexible installation, automatic adjustment of water output and self-cleaning, high uniformity of water output, but it is complicated to manufacture and expensive.
